OverviewLove it or hate it, math is behind much of what makes today's modern world run smoothly. Readers will find out just how important math is to their everyday lives--and to important human advancements such as exploring Mars--with this intriguing title that features ten fun, math-powered activities. Step-by-step instructions and colorful illustrations will guide readers through activities including creating an obstacle course for a Mars rover and using a shadow to measure Earth's circumference. Carefully crafted text breaks down key mathematical curricula concepts including physics, angles, and energy.
